Santa came to Lampeter last week and was greeted with a large crowd.
The man in red visited the town as the traditional Lampeter Late Night Opening and Christmas Fayre returned – after having to be cancelled in 2020.
The evening was full of festive joy and plenty on offer for young and old.
Santa began his journey through town at Hafan Deg care home, and stood with Mayor Selwyn Walters, Lois Wakeman (Chair of Lampeter Chamber of Trade) and Lampeter Town Crier Ivor Williams as they opened the event.
Musical entertainment throughout the event was provided by Côr Cwmann, Lampeter Ukulele Club, John Frith, Yeller Dog String Band. Stepp Up Puppeteers entertained the children as they waited to enter Santa’s grotto at The Mustard Seed Cafe.
Marchnad Llambed ensured there was a delightful provision of market stalls that evening too, creating a wonderful Christmas market vibe that was enjoyed by all.
